Vanilla Ice Cream (Longstaff)
2 tsp Gelatin
2 tbsp Hot water
1 1/4 cup Evaporated milk, chilled
1 tsp Vanilla
4 tbsp Sugar equivalent sweetener


Dissolve gelatin in hot water. Whisk the milk and almost cold gelatin
together and add the flavoring and sweetener.

Pour into freezing trays and freeze without stirring. Serve with
fruit.

8 servings each 60 cal, 5 g (1/2 unit) carbohydrate, 4 g protein, 3 g
fat

Source: The Diabetic's Cookbook by Roberta Longstaff & Jim Mann 1984
Shared but not tested by Elizabeth Rodier July 1993

Losing weight

If you wish to get thinner and improve your overall health, then, as any dietician will tell you, you need to start a precisely planned solid weight loss program. Theoretically, this ought to involve five standard portions of fruit and vegetables daily and require an appropriate mix of fat, carbohydrates and proteins.

At the start of a diet, people usually pick out retail store and big brand products claiming to be 'low-fat'. To do this is most certainly wrong, as a food might just be significantly reduced in fat, but whilst still remaining elavated in calories and carbohydrates.

In deciding on a weight loss regime, it is important to also attempt to cut ingestion of refined carbohydrate, fats and salt.
